For PCV, you're on your own. These cars breathed through the intake base I think.


It depends on the motor but, most small blocks had a oil filler tube ( about 1 1/4 dia.,roughly 4 in. high) that was pushed into a hole in the front of the intake. On some the PVC was screwed into the tube.
On some likea 250 or 300 horse in '65, it was just a hose, no PCV valve at all.
The other end of the hose ran to a bunch of places, carb at the bottom, carb at the top and into the aircleaner bottom plate.
